Remembrance Day 2022

14 Nov 2022
Written by Hannah Carrick
OWBA

Lest We Forget.

A moving and poignant remembrance service was held at school on Friday morning for Armistice Day.  The service included an interview between Headmaster, Mr Stapleton and our two Ukrainian students, who were so articulate in their description of how the war with Russia has affected their families and their feelings of guilt having left loved ones in Ukraine.  

OWBA President Suzy Conchie (80-84G) read the Roll of Honour and laid a wreath on behalf of the OWBA.
